Understanding the Milestone:

What is a Milestone?

A milestone is not just a point on a timeline; it’s a symbol of achievement, a testament to progress. In project management, it’s a significant event or phase completion. In your personal life, it could be landing your dream job, completing a marathon, or achieving a personal goal.

Planning the Perfect Setup:

Define Clear Objectives: Before diving into setting milestones, define your project or personal objectives clearly. What are you aiming to achieve? Having a crystal-clear vision sets the foundation for meaningful milestones.

Break It Down: Divide your project or personal goal into smaller, manageable tasks. Breaking down larger goals makes them less overwhelming and more achievable.

Set Realistic Timelines: Be mindful of time constraints. Setting realistic timelines ensures that milestones are achievable and helps maintain momentum. Remember, Rome wasn’t built in a day!

Things to Keep in Mind:

Flexibility is Key: While milestones provide structure, life is unpredictable. Be flexible and adapt to unforeseen changes. It’s not about avoiding detours but adjusting your route when necessary.

Celebrate Small Wins: Acknowledging and celebrating small victories along the way boosts morale and keeps motivation high. It’s the journey, not just the destination, that shapes character.

The Mindset Impact:

Scientific Perspective: From a psychological standpoint, achieving milestones triggers the release of dopamine — the “feel-good” neurotransmitter. This positive reinforcement strengthens neural pathways, making you more resilient and better equipped to tackle challenges.
